Trey Wingenter has signed with the Seibu Lions of Japan’s Nippon Professional Baseball.
Wingenter will take his talents overseas after being non-tendered a couple weeks ago by the Cubs. The hard-throwing 30-year-old righty reliever has made 97 appearances in the big leagues dating back to 2018.
